March 07, 2007 - Fayt-le-Franc, Belgium - Yesterday Team Slipstream rolled out onto the roads of Belgium for it’s first European race of the 2007 season. The 39th edition of Memorial Samyn was 191 km on the flat, narrow country roads around Fayt-le-Franc; the race finished with a lead group of almost 30 riders sprinting for the win.
Team Slipstream’s young Dutchman, Huub Duyn, was top finisher on the day, making the lead group and ending up as 12th place in the sprint. Duyn’s teammate Benny Johnson (AUS) finished in a small group that trailed just 17 seconds behind the leaders.
